NY Post': Those Who Oppose 'Surge' in Congress Are Guilty of 'Treason'
NEW YORK "TREASON" screamed the front page of the New York Post today, in reaction to Friday's vote in the House of Representatives which easily passed a nonbinding resolution opposing President Bush's troop surge in Iraq. Seventeen Republicans joined the Democrats in that vote.

The Post's Ralph Peters caleld it "the most disgraceful congressional action since the Democratic Party united to defend slavery"-- roughly 150 years ago.

Peters charged, "Providing aid and comfort to the enemy in wartime is treason. It's not 'just politics.' It's treason....
